First Ever Appreciation 1970

 For an aircraft to fly safe, all its flight instruments are made serviceable in instrument Overhaul Shop.

All the Test Equipment is maintained in good working condition and updated by another workshop called Ground Equipment Maintenance Shop. This is the real life line of the aircraft to be serviceable much before the flight departure time.

A Steering Computer of Boeing 707 Flight Director System was stuck in the shop since a year and a half it came in Instrument Overhaul Shop for repair. Almost all the experts of shop tried their best including seniors but it could not me made serviceable for the flight and the spare one was being used. I voluntarily accepted to repair the same and within one and a half month I made it. The management was very glad to know as I saved a hell of an amount of foreign exchange to get repaired abroad by the manufacturer. Hence an appreciation letter was issued to me from the higher ups to pin up with my Personal File. It was first ever appreciation of my life from a reputable organization like PIA.This is not a small piece of paper but a remarkable Pride of my Parents, my children and the generations to come indeed.  

A Steering Computer is used in manual flight to control the aircraft by pilot manipulation of the flight controls. Movement of the control yoke, control column or control stick (as fitted) and the rudder pedals result in corresponding movements of the aircraft control surfaces (aileronselevator and rudder) which in turn cause the aircraft to rotate around any or all of the three axes of rotation.. An autopilot reduces pilot workload by guiding an aircraft using computer input instead of direct control manipulation.
